XCODE_ATTRIBUTE_<an-attribute> ------------------------------ Set Xcode target attributes directly. Tell the :generator:`Xcode` generator to set '<an-attribute>' to a given value in the generated Xcode project. Ignored on other generators. See the :variable:`CMAKE_XCODE_ATTRIBUTE_<an-attribute>` variable to set attributes on all targets in a directory tree. Contents of ``XCODE_ATTRIBUTE_<an-attribute>`` may use "generator expressions" with the syntax ``$<...>``. See the :manual:`cmake3-generator-expressions(7)` manual for available expressions. See the :manual:`cmake3-buildsystem(7)` manual for more on defining buildsystem properties.
